Sumar archivos de una carpeta

Quisiera saber si conocéis alguna manera que al abrir un archivo excel se coloque en una celda la suma de archivos .pdf de otra carpeta más uno

1 Respuesta

Respuesta
1

Utiliza la siguiente macro. Cambia los datos de carpeta, hoja y celda por tus datos

Sub Contar_Pdf()
  Dim arch As Variant
  Dim ruta As String
  Dim n As Long
  '
  ruta = "C:\trabajo\"
  arch = Dir(ruta & "*.pdf")
  '
  Do While arch <> ""
    n = n + 1
    arch = Dir()
  Loop
  Sheets("Hoja1").Range("A1").Value = n + 1
End Sub

Si quieres que se ejecute en automático, llama la macro desde el evento Open.

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as